Quercus cerris

Turkey Oak has a strange name which is derived from the fact that the deeply lobed foliage resembles the shape of a Turkey's foot!  The foliage can vary, some leaves being lobed and pointed whilst other leaves can be rounded making it quite interesting. Autumn sees the leaves turn to yellow, copper and rust.

This large, strudy tree can reach 25m, and is native to South Eastern Europe and is hardy to strong wind, frost and dry spells. The trunk is dark grey, with deeply lined fissures running through it, adding contrast.  Best suited to large gardens or farms and would make a great feature tree, avenue tree or windbreak.

Washingtonia robusta 

Common names: Mexican Cotton Fan Palm, Mexican Fan Palm, Mexican washingtonia, Washingtonia palm. The Mexican Cotton Fan Palm is a medium-tall sized palm originating from Mexico. It can reach a mature height of 7m in Victoria's climate. It has large fan like fronds with remnant threads of foliage that appear like ‘cotton’ hanging from between frond segments. It is tough, drought and frost tolerant when established! It is a perfect addition for features and tropical gardens. 100 litre pot.

Erigeron karvinskianus

Daisy Spray or Seaside Daisy is a hardy perennial shrub with little daisy flowers of pink and white. • Only grows 15cm tall! • Perfect for borders, pots and the cottage style garden • Tolerates heat, drought, poor soils and frost
ContentDaisy Spray Erigeron is a superior form of the Seaside Daisy, Erigeron karvinskianus, that will grow into a compact mound 60 cm in diameter and 40 cm tall. Daisy Spray Erigeron retains its compact shape & dosen’t self-sow and spread throughout the garden.
